Action item from the Larkspun outage: vendor all third-party fonts into the Mossgate CDN bundle. External font host timeouts blanked the checkout UI for 40 minutes; support saw the ticket spike. Owner: platform team, due next sprint. Support should reference cached-asset TTLs when triaging stale-font reports. Fallback stacks are now mandatory in every theme. The relevant tuning constants are given below.

tuning table, yajog-yahof:
BUDGETS = {
    "lamvan": 303,
    "wenox": 460,
    "fenvan": 525,
}

# Runbook: Hunting leaked file descriptors in Quillgate

When the `fd_open` gauge climbs steadily between deploys, suspect a leak rather than load. First confirm on a single pod: exec in and count entries under `/proc/1/fd`, noting how many are sockets in CLOSE_WAIT versus regular files. Capture two snapshots ten minutes apart before restarting anything — we need the delta for the postmortem. Reproduce locally with the Marbury load harness, which requires the service running with the following configuration values.

settings of yagep-bajog:
[istdor]
port = 4000
region = south-2
host = istdor.qorvelcorp.internal
timeout_ms = 5000
retries = 5

Facilities ticket – Hallowick Labs, Building C. Prototype workshop door (room C-12) failing to latch since Monday. Strike plate loose; door swings open in draught. Bench equipment inside includes the Ferrowell mill, so this is a priority. Temporary fix attempted by Oskar from the tooling team; did not hold. Please send a locksmith before Thursday's build sprint. Access outside core hours requires sign-in at the south desk. The entry pad on C-12 is still active and accepts the standard workshop code below.

badge for haduf-bafop: bdg-O-78